btrfs: split alloc_log_tree()
This is a preparation patch for the next patch. Split alloc_log_tree() into two parts. The first one allocating the tree structure, remains in alloc_log_tree() and the second part allocating the tree node, which is moved into btrfs_alloc_log_tree_node(). Also export the latter part is to be used in the next patch.
